Tatra T603
I just can’t help it. (Can I get a boo-yah, guys?). And military hardware that can race is even better… And rare. But that is exactly what this is… Czech military hardware that runs in events like Dakar and does off-road trials.
Tatra.
The make 4x4s, 6x6s, 8x8s, 10x10s and even 12x12s… 12x12s. How cool is THAT?
They also made a seriously ugly/cool car, the T603. I’m not saying that I’m going to run out and get one… but it is kinda cool… in a freaky kinda way.
But this is about cool trucks.

Well if you like T603 than you should google T77 which was the world's first aerodynamic car in serial production. And IF you see pictures of T77 alongside with other prewar cars (as it was manufactured since 1934), you would not just believe that this car was to be seen on the roads of the era.
As to the military equipment, the tatras have unique backbone tube concept (find it on youtube), which makes it the best option for offroad conditions.
